Smith Medical, based in Denver, CO, is a multispecialty surgical facility that focuses on premium direct specialty care through a direct pay surgery model. This approach emphasizes transparent pricing and quality care, allowing patients to bypass traditional insurance hurdles such as approvals and high deductibles. Smith Medical offers all-inclusive package pricing that covers diagnostics, anesthesia, and procedures upfront, typically at costs that are 40% lower than insurance-based models. The facility provides cash-based, insurance-free surgical procedures across various specialties, supported by a procedure pricing tool for immediate cost estimates. Smith Medical prioritizes patient well-being and offers comprehensive support throughout the patient journey, including consultations, pre-surgery preparation, and post-care. The team consists of highly trained, board-certified surgeons who are committed to delivering personalized care. Smith Medical targets patients with high-deductible insurance, self-insured individuals, and those without coverage, ensuring broad accessibility to quality surgical services.

Automated Patient Intake and Registration

Streamlining the patient intake process reduces administrative burden on staff and improves the patient experience. This allows front-office teams to focus on higher-value interactions rather than repetitive data entry and form completion. Efficient registration is critical for accurate billing and timely care.

Up to 50% reduction in manual intake timeIndustry benchmarks for healthcare administrative automation
An AI agent can guide patients through pre-visit registration via a secure portal or app, collecting necessary demographic, insurance, and medical history information. It can then validate data against existing records and flag discrepancies for human review.

Intelligent Appointment Scheduling and Reminders

Optimizing appointment scheduling minimizes no-shows and maximizes provider utilization. Effective communication reduces patient confusion and improves adherence to care plans. This directly impacts revenue cycles and operational efficiency.

10-20% reduction in no-show ratesHealthcare patient engagement studies
This agent manages appointment booking based on provider availability, patient needs, and insurance eligibility. It can also send personalized, multi-channel reminders and facilitate rescheduling requests automatically.

AI-Powered Medical Coding and Billing Support

Accurate and timely medical coding is essential for correct reimbursement and compliance. Manual coding is prone to errors and delays, impacting cash flow. Automation can improve precision and speed up the revenue cycle.

5-15% improvement in coding accuracyMedical billing and coding industry reports
An AI agent reviews clinical documentation to suggest appropriate ICD-10 and CPT codes. It can also identify potential billing errors or missing information before claims are submitted, reducing denials.

Automated Patient Follow-Up and Care Management

Post-visit follow-up is crucial for patient recovery and adherence to treatment plans, but can be resource-intensive. Proactive outreach improves patient outcomes and can reduce readmission rates. This enhances patient satisfaction and operational efficiency.

Up to 25% increase in patient adherencePatient outcome and engagement research
This agent contacts patients after appointments or procedures to check on their well-being, answer common questions, and ensure they are following care instructions. It can escalate concerns to clinical staff as needed.

Streamlined Prior Authorization Processing

The prior authorization process is a significant administrative bottleneck, often delaying necessary treatments and straining staff resources. Automating this workflow can accelerate care delivery and reduce administrative overhead.

30-60% faster prior authorization turnaroundHealthcare administrative efficiency studies
An AI agent can gather necessary patient and clinical data, submit prior authorization requests to payers, and track their status. It can also flag requests requiring further human intervention or appeal.

Intelligent Medical Record Summarization

Quickly accessing and understanding key patient information is vital for effective clinical decision-making. Manually sifting through extensive medical records consumes valuable clinician time. AI can provide concise summaries of critical data.

Up to 70% reduction in time spent reviewing recordsClinical workflow optimization benchmarks
This agent analyzes patient charts and extracts salient information, such as past diagnoses, medications, allergies, and recent treatments, presenting it in a condensed, easy-to-digest format for clinicians.

What can AI agents do for an operations business like Smith Medical?
AI agents can automate repetitive administrative tasks, streamline workflows, and improve data accuracy. For operations businesses, this often includes intelligent document processing for invoices and forms, automated scheduling and dispatch, proactive equipment maintenance alerts, and enhanced customer service through AI-powered chatbots that handle initial inquiries. These capabilities allow human staff to focus on more complex, value-added activities.
How do AI agents ensure safety and compliance in operations?
AI agents are designed with robust security protocols and can be configured to adhere strictly to industry regulations. For operations, this means ensuring data privacy, maintaining audit trails for all automated actions, and flagging potential compliance deviations in real-time. Regular audits and adherence to data governance frameworks are standard practice when deploying AI agents in regulated environments like operations.
What is the typical timeline for deploying AI agents in an operations setting?
The timeline varies based on complexity, but initial deployments for specific use cases, such as automating accounts payable or customer support inquiries, often take 3-6 months. This includes phases for discovery, configuration, testing, and phased rollout. More comprehensive deployments involving multiple workflows may extend to 9-12 months.
Can we start with a pilot program for AI agents?
Yes, pilot programs are a common and recommended approach. They allow you to test AI agents on a limited scope, such as a single department or a specific process like intake management or data entry verification. This enables you to measure impact, identify any challenges, and refine the solution before a full-scale rollout, typically lasting 1-3 months.
What data and integration are needed for AI agents?
AI agents typically require access to relevant operational data, which may reside in your ERP, CRM, document management systems, or databases. Integration is usually achieved through APIs or secure data connectors. The specific requirements depend on the use case, but clean, accessible data is crucial for effective AI performance. Companies often start by identifying key data sources for the pilot.
How are staff trained to work with AI agents?
Training focuses on how to interact with the AI, interpret its outputs, and manage exceptions. For operational staff, this might involve learning how to review AI-generated reports, handle escalated customer queries, or oversee automated processes. Training programs are typically role-specific and can range from short workshops to more in-depth sessions, often supported by user guides and ongoing support.
How do AI agents support multi-location operations?
AI agents can standardize processes across all locations, ensuring consistent service delivery and operational efficiency regardless of site. They can manage distributed data, provide centralized reporting, and automate tasks that are common to all branches, such as compliance checks or inventory updates. This scalability is a key benefit for multi-location organizations.
How is the return on investment (ROI) measured for AI agents?
ROI is typically measured by quantifying improvements in efficiency, cost reduction, and error reduction. Key metrics include reduced processing times for tasks, decreased labor costs associated with manual work, improved data accuracy leading to fewer rework instances, and enhanced customer satisfaction scores.
